1975 HONDA CB360T

This is a beautiful 1975 Honda CB360T "survivor" with only 9,179 miles! The bike has not been restored and appears to be all original with the exception of mufflers, battery and tires. The bike runs excellent, rides great, and everything works as it should. There is a little wear and tear but for the most part the bike is in great condition for it's age. Please read the entire listing and review all photos closely. Feel free to ask any questions you may have.

  • Low mileage, original condition "survivor", not restored!
  • Runs and rides excellent, everything works as it should
  • On the road last season
  • Some typical wear and tear/scratches/dings/light rust, etc. but for the most part in great shape for it's age
  • Original paint shines nice but does have some scratches and a some fading around the gas cap, see photos
  • A few minor dents in gas tank, some cracks in side covers, and a tear in the seat, see photos
  • Tires have lots of tread left and look great but there are a couple spots with cracks, see photos
  • Battery replaced recently
  • Mufflers replaced recently

McGuinness Tests Mugen Shinden Electric Race Bike

Thu, 22 Mar 2012

Isle of Man TT veteran John McGuinness recently got a chance to test the new Mugen Shinden electric rice bike to prepare for the 2012 TT Zero. The test took place at the Twin Ring Motegi in Japan, a world-class racing circuit but perhaps not-coincidentally, a track built and owned by Honda, further fueling the belief the Mugen effort is a front for the Japanese manufacturer. The Honda-contracted McGuinness put the Shinden through its first big test, helping the Mugen team gather data on the electric racer.
